CORN BREAD



Corn Bread image

Our renovated Corn Bread makes the perfect side dish for chili, soups and stews.

Categories     Dinner,Lunch,Breakfast,Brunch,Appetizers,Snack

Time 30m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 cup(s) Uncooked unenriched white cornmeal yellow
1 cup(s) All-purpose flour
2 tsp(s) Baking powder
0.75 tsp(s) Table salt
0.5 tsp(s) Baking soda
14.75 oz Cream style corn canned
0.5 cup(s) Low-fat buttermilk
2 egg white(s), large Egg white(s)
0.667 tbsp(s) Corn oil

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400ºF. Coat an 8-inch square cake pan with cooking spray.
  • Combine cornmeal, flour, baking powder, salt and baking soda in a large bowl. Mix well with a fork, then make a well in the centre; set aside.
  • Combine creamed corn, buttermilk, egg whites and oil in a medium bowl; mix until blended. Fold mixture into dry ingredients; mix until blended. Pour batter into prepared pan and smooth the top.
  • Bake until a wooden pick inserted near the centre com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Allow to cool in pan on a wire rack for 10 minutes. Remove from pan; cool completely before cutting into 8 squares.

SOUTHERN CORNBREAD



Southern Cornbread image

Provided by Cat Cora

Categories     side-dish

Time 45m

Yield 4-6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

5 tablespoons unsalted butter, plus more for the pan
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
3/4 cup yellow cornmeal
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up buttermilk (shake before measuring)
2 large eggs

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F and position a rack in the middle. Butter an 8-inch-square baking pan.
  • Melt the butter in the microwave in a microwave-safe dish in three 15-second intervals on high or in a small pan on the stove. Set it aside to cool.
  • In a bowl, whisk together the flour, cornmeal, baking powder, baking soda and salt.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the buttermilk and the eggs. Add the melted butter. Add the flour-cornmeal mixture and stir just until combined. Pour the batter into the pan. Bake until the cornbread just begins to br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 18 to 23 minutes. Cool for about 10 minutes before serving.

CREAMED CORN CORNBREAD



Creamed Corn Cornbread image

Bake Alton Brown's perfect Creamed Corn Cornbread recipe from Good Eats on Food Network in a cast-iron skillet using cornmeal, buttermilk and creamed corn.

Provided by Alton Brown

Categories     side-dish

Time 35m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 cups yellow cornmeal
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 tablespoon s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1 cup buttermilk
2 eggs
1 cup creamed corn
2 tablespoons canola oil

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
  • Place a 10-inch cast iron skillet into the oven.
  • In a bowl, combine the cornmeal, salt, sugar, baking powder, and baking soda. Whisk together to combine well.
  • In a large bowl, combine the buttermilk, eggs, and creamed corn, whisking together to combine thoroughly. Add the dry ingredients to the buttermilk mixture and stir to combine. If the batter will not pour, add more buttermilk to the batter.
  • Swirl the canola oil in the hot cast iron skillet. Pour the batter into the skillet. Bake until the cornbread is golden brown and springs back upon the touch, about 20 minutes.

WEIGHT WATCHERS BASIC SKILLET CORNBREAD



Weight Watchers Basic Skillet Cornbread image

Makes 10 servings at 3 ww pts per wedge. This came from a Simple Goodness Magazine from 1997. This cornbread is wonderful.

Provided by Crystal B.

Categories     Breads

Time 25m

Yield 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 1/2 cups yellow cornmeal
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
2 cups low-fat buttermilk
1 1/2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 large egg, lightly beaten
2 large egg whites, lightly beaten

Steps:

  • Preheat oven 450 degrees.
  • Combine first 5 ingredients in a large bowl; make a well in center of mixture. Combine buttermilk, oil, egg and egg whites; add to dry ingredients, stirring just until moist.
  • Place a 10-inch cast-iron skillet in a 450 degree oven. for 5 minutes or until hot. remove skillet from oven; coat with cooking spray, and immediately pour batter into hot skillet.
  • Bake at 450 degrees for 20 minutes or until lightly browned.
  • Remove cornbread from skillet immediately.
  • Yield 10 servings.
  • Serving Size 1 wedge @ 3 ww pts.

CORNMEAL-BATTERED FISH AND CHIPS - WW CORE



Cornmeal-Battered Fish and Chips - Ww Core image

This recipe is adapted from the Weight Watchers website. Still kept the recipe low fat/points, but added a bit more flavor and spice to the fish. I LOVE the potato wedges baked with salt, pepper and vinegar right in them!! They were delicious!

Provided by Kozmic Blues

Categories     Potato

Time 55m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 15

nonstick cooking spray
1 1/2 cups yellow cornmeal, uncooked
1 cup skim milk
1 teaspoon lemon zest
1 teaspoon dried basil
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on Old Bay Seasoning (or other seafood seasoning) (optional)
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 1/4 lbs cod fish fillets or 1 1/4 lbs haddock fillets
2 tablespoons yellow cornmeal, for dusting fish
2 large idaho potatoes,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ch-thick wedges
2 tablespoons white vinegar or 2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1/2 teaspoon table sal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per, freshly ground

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400ºF.
  • Coat a large baking sheet with cooking spray.
  • In a shallow dish, combine 1 1/2 cups of cornmeal, milk, zest, basil, oregano, salt, pepper and Old Bay (if using).
  • Mix well to make a thick batter. (It is helpful to let batter sit for a bit to let all the milk get absorbed).
  • Salt and pepper the fish fillets to taste on both sides.
  • Dust fish with additional 2 Tbsp cornmeal and shake off any excess; This will help cormeal batter to stick.
  • Affter milk is absorbed and cornmeal batter has thickened, stir once more to combine well.
  • Add fish to batter and turn to coat both sides.
  • Place fish on prepared baking sheet and spoon over any remaining batter, making an even coating.
  • Place potatoes in a large bowl and add vinegar, salt and pepper; toss to coat. Arrange potatoes next to fish on baking sheet.
  • Bake until potatoes and fish are fork-tender and cornmeal batter just starts to crack, carefully flipping fish once, about 30 to 35 minutes.
